Ignis’ stomach churned when she saw it, but she couldn’t look away. This beast was fantastically grotesque and powerful. The engineer estimated this monster to be a little weaker than the dragon and a lot less intelligent than Ego. Ears ringing from the awful shriek the beast emitted, Ignis tightened her index finger in the trigger of her pistol as the engineer took aim. Her drone was quick to swoop ahead of her and aim several shots at the beast while it was down.
Dark eyes tracked the projectiles, searching for a weak point as the drone flew away from the flying demon in an abstract zig zag flight pattern. Pulse racing at a dizzying pace, Ignis started moving with the group toward the choke point. Her eyes strayed from their enemies just long enough to ascertain that she would not make a deadly misstep in the narrow pass. For good measure, she sent a pair of bullets at one of the hounds Catello had knocked over.
Spitefully, she hoped the demon hound wouldn’t get up. Sharp teeth dug into Ignis’ lower lip and her breath hitched. The engineer sucked in cool air through her nose, ignoring the scent of gunpowder and demon blood, and steeled herself. Heroes couldn’t be overwhelmed or freeze, no matter how many powerful enemies faced them.
“Any ideas for the big one?” Ignis called out, “I might be able to stun it if I get close, but I’ll need back up.” The avian couldn’t be sure this creature would freeze up like that basilisk she’d fought; anything that made sounds that awful probably didn’t have sharp ears. All the same, if she could keep it from attacking them for even a short while, it would be worth it. After all, heroes had to take risks, sometimes. The engineer had played it safe with Ego because he was an unknown factor, intelligent enough to be worried about and difficult to hit. This brute, while large and powerful, seemed to lack Ego’s cunning and evasive abilities.
Ignis wiped her tongue over her chapped lips and took a few more deep breaths to steady herself.
Amicus clung to her neck, already drawing on her magic. The familiar had learned that although his contractor could recognize that sometimes it was better to be careful, he would never truly get her to stop running into danger head first.
